Bertogne is a Walloon municipality of Belgium located in the province of Luxembourg. On 1 January 2007 the municipality, which covers 91.67 km², had 3,002 inhabitants, giving a population density of 32.7 inhabitants per km².

The municipality consists of the following sub-municipalities: Bertogne proper, Flamierge, and Longchamps. Other population centers include:
